The scene of action at the annual Summer Festival which is now in progress in this tourist resort shifted to the Ooty lake.
With a large number of tourists making a bee line to the venue at the far end of the town, the annual boat race was conducted in an interesting manner by the Nilgiris district administration, the Tamil Nadu Tourism Development Corporation and the Department of Tourism.
The race was flagged off by the Nilgiris Collector Archana Patnaik.
The District Revenue Officer S.Kuppusamy distributed the prizes.
Many of the tourists interviewed by The Hindu said that more such “lively” programmes should be organized to entertain the tourists.
They were in tune with the ethos of the hill station.
Pointing out that they came to Udhagamandalam mainly to enjoy the weather and get away from the noise in the plains, they opined that programmes organized for the benefit of the visitors should reflect the culture and lifestyle of the natives.
A number of tourists participated enthusiastically in various categories of the event.
